{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":374820,"defaultBranch":"main","name":"billiard","ownerLogin":"celery","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2009-11-16T15:39:48.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/319983?v=4","public":true,"private":false,"isOrgOwned":true},"refInfo":{"name":"","listCacheKey":"v0:1699248144.0","currentOid":""},"activityList":{"items":[{"before":"8619ad0df94b02ffea30ab1c562b1fdaa71dd7e4","after":"8bffa2c2067f43da746c8f4e890c5a007bab0a12","ref":"refs/heads/main","pushedAt":"2024-01-30T09:00:40.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"add on_ready_counter to reduction","shortMessageHtmlLink":"add on_ready_counter to reduction"}},{"before":"13922230092a4191583e592e9c6d49f912a3fd03","after":"8619ad0df94b02ffea30ab1c562b1fdaa71dd7e4","ref":"refs/heads/main","pushedAt":"2024-01-29T13:33:16.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"Remove `SIGUSR2` from `TERMSIGS_DEAULT`","shortMessageHtmlLink":"Remove SIGUSR2 from TERMSIGS_DEAULT"}},{"before":"db3774c5920ea4177b075b9f142f4538df339da3","after":"13922230092a4191583e592e9c6d49f912a3fd03","ref":"refs/heads/main","pushedAt":"2023-11-06T05:22:24.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"Bump version: 4.1.0 → 4.2.0","shortMessageHtmlLink":"Bump version: 4.1.0 → 4.2.0"}},{"before":"ecc682742e4b315fc01f385d1b1636ffbe0eb772","after":null,"ref":"refs/heads/py312","pushedAt":"2023-11-05T13:17:18.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"thedrow","name":"Omer Katz","path":"/thedrow","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/48936?s=80&v=4"}},{"before":"adaa178bfc6b4821667298108199abd1b4389933","after":"db3774c5920ea4177b075b9f142f4538df339da3","ref":"refs/heads/main","pushedAt":"2023-11-05T10:25: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"Delete appveyor.yml","shortMessageHtmlLink":"Delete appveyor.yml"}},{"before":"65f6863a856f158bf080ecac2051a0f1e48fce19","after":"adaa178bfc6b4821667298108199abd1b4389933","ref":"refs/heads/main","pushedAt":"2023-11-05T10:21:17.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"changed nose test to pytest (#397)","shortMessageHtmlLink":"changed nose test to pytest (#397)"}},{"before":null,"after":"2a93d543bdb6dde580b05ac56d407732004b16b7","ref":"refs/heads/nose","pushedAt":"2023-11-05T10:08:55.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"changed nose test to pytest","shortMessageHtmlLink":"changed nose test to pytest"}},{"before":"2190f7ed07b700f401883a30153bf5a8cc30632e","after":null,"ref":"refs/heads/nose","pushedAt":"2023-11-05T10:08:35.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"}},{"before":"48bfadea232bf8eb029acdcc964f4dfc4d3f17a0","after":"65f6863a856f158bf080ecac2051a0f1e48fce19","ref":"refs/heads/main","pushedAt":"2023-11-05T09:55:37.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"change nose dependency (#383)","shortMessageHtmlLink":"change nose dependency (#383)"}},{"before":"ddb28584ada62d82c32e4f3daa51512d98a05b15","after":"48bfadea232bf8eb029acdcc964f4dfc4d3f17a0","ref":"refs/heads/main","pushedAt":"2023-11-05T09:37:09.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"added python 3.12 to CI (#396)","shortMessageHtmlLink":"added python 3.12 to CI (#396)"}},{"before":null,"after":"ecc682742e4b315fc01f385d1b1636ffbe0eb772","ref":"refs/heads/py312","pushedAt":"2023-11-05T09:31:52.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"added python 3.12 to CI","shortMessageHtmlLink":"added python 3.12 to CI"}},{"before":"17037e55c3bec0309d9ff008b76a8296b2da43e3","after":"ddb28584ada62d82c32e4f3daa51512d98a05b15","ref":"refs/heads/main","pushedAt":"2023-11-05T09:12:04.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"FIX: Replaced mktemp usage for PY2","shortMessageHtmlLink":"FIX: Replaced mktemp usage for PY2"}},{"before":"32e51b50aa3e6eaec597f5587c41951376554066","after":"17037e55c3bec0309d9ff008b76a8296b2da43e3","ref":"refs/heads/main","pushedAt":"2023-10-29T13:04:21.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"fix(co_positions): resolve issue caused by absence `co_positions` (#395)\n\n* fix(co_positions): resolve issue caused by absence `co_positions` attribute on billiard _Object class in the `billiard/einfo.py`;\r\n\r\nPython 3.11 introduced a new attribute `co_positions` for `code` objects, inspired by PEP-0657. This has led to compatibility issues with the `billiard` library, specifically the `_Object` class in `billiard/einfo.py`, which lacks the `co_positions` attribute. This affects the error handling and logging mechanisms, resulting in AttributeError exceptions.\r\n\r\n* feat(einfo): Add additional unit test on `einfo` internal classes;\r\n\r\n---------\r\n\r\nCo-authored-by: Max Nikitenko ","shortMessageHtmlLink":"fix(co_positions): resolve issue caused by absence co_positions (#395)"}},{"before":"9a2e341ef329104144319f27b20afac1f05698f3","after":null,"ref":"refs/heads/ci","pushedAt":"2023-08-04T06:17:02.000Z","pushType":"branch_deletion","commitsCount":0,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"}},{"before":"cbe5a3f3e22014cc2dd0cd5df1c1fc35859584a0","after":"32e51b50aa3e6eaec597f5587c41951376554066","ref":"refs/heads/main","pushedAt":"2023-08-04T06:16:59.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"remove python 3.7","shortMessageHtmlLink":"remove python 3.7"}},{"before":"5030d32c3230956e0cfb08cdb410807ec26fe88a","after":"cbe5a3f3e22014cc2dd0cd5df1c1fc35859584a0","ref":"refs/heads/main","pushedAt":"2023-07-24T07:54:25.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"adjust the __repr__ in ApplyResult\n\nchange the replacement field %s to {name} in __repr__ in ApplyResult, since this line uses format().","shortMessageHtmlLink":"adjust the __repr__ in ApplyResult"}},{"before":null,"after":"9a2e341ef329104144319f27b20afac1f05698f3","ref":"refs/heads/ci","pushedAt":"2023-07-24T07:53:37.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"remove python 3.7","shortMessageHtmlLink":"remove python 3.7"}},{"before":"57200e7b5cfa710e6d3a695ecb12506afba465f0","after":"5030d32c3230956e0cfb08cdb410807ec26fe88a","ref":"refs/heads/main","pushedAt":"2023-07-24T07:52:36.000Z","pushType":"pr_merge","commitsCount":1,"pusher":{"login":"auvipy","name":"Asif Saif Uddin","path":"/auvipy","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6212603?s=80&v=4"},"commit":{"message":"Update process.py to close during join only if process has completed\n\nIf a timeout is set, the wait will return before process exit. `close` deletes the sentinel and breaks future `join` calls.","shortMessageHtmlLink":"Update process.py to close during join only if process has completed"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AD7LYcfwA","startCursor":null,"endCursor":null}},"title":"Activity · celery/billiard"}